Recognise Ultra Sparc and compiler version number.
[oweals/openssl.git] / apps / pkcs12.c
index 89ee3a7b797b511a13172f3f2e792515bdfb5a94..b056b8417234b1c886c595ec504e6934b299f71f 100644 (file)
@@ -638,8 +638,8 @@ int print_attribs (BIO *out, STACK *attrlst, char *name)
                        BIO_printf(out, ": ");
                } else BIO_printf(out, "%s: ", OBJ_nid2ln(attr_nid));
 
-               if(sk_num(attr->value.set)) {
-                       av = (ASN1_TYPE *)sk_value(attr->value.set, 0);
+               if(sk_ASN1_TYPE_num(attr->value.set)) {
+                       av = sk_ASN1_TYPE_value(attr->value.set, 0);
                        switch(av->type) {
                                case V_ASN1_BMPSTRING:
                                value = uni2asc(av->value.bmpstring->data,